A Russian painted icon of the Mother of God of Kazan, 19th century
supporting her son on her lap, attended by three saints, some distress, paint loss and water damage, 31cm high, 25cm wide; and a Russian painted oval icon of Saint Matthew, 19th century, the seated writing figure raised on a blue ambon, within an architectural setting, attended by an angel, some paint loss, chips, 20cm high
(2)
